Explore writing through flash cards

for word building 

​

 

PROCEDURE: Depending on the child's interest and need, choose a theme like Animals, Birds, Fruits, Vegetables, Colours, Shapes, Transport, months of the year etc.

In this presentation we use the topic Animals. Choose around 10 pictures of animals with 3 to 4 lettered names like cow dog cat etc .

Take print out. Make two sets. Laminate one set of the cards with the name of the animal. For the other set laminate the picture of the animal and the label of the name separately.

Flash cards helps in visual stimulation and overall cognitive development.

 HOW TO USE FLASH CARDS: Flash cards are very versatile and this material can be used in four stages for different age groups.

MATCHING PICTURES: At the first stage, for children aged 30 to 36 months can use the pictures as matching cards.

MATCHING LABELS: At the second stage children over 3 years who can recognise and read letters can match the cards and recognise the name of the animal and label it.

FORMING WORDS: Children over 3.5 years who have not started writing yet, but can recognise the letters and words can pick letters from the letter tray and make words. A letter tray tray is a tray with moveable alphabets. It is available in Dollarstore.

WRITING WORDS: Children who are ready to write can use the label as a reference and write the words. 

Cards can be made for different topics like animals, birds, fruits, vegetables etc. Children can learn with the help of these cards.
